Hi Stephane,

I don't have the Power9 documentation (Will Schmidt, is there a public version 
of power 9 docs available now?), so I don't know the details of the contraints 
on how different event can (and cannot) be concurrently used.  There was some 
earlier discussion on the papi mailing list about papi preset PAPI_L1_DCM being 
unusable on power9 because the PM_LD_MISS_L1 and PM_ST_MISS_L1 could not be 
used concurrently on power9.  Power has some alternative codings for some of 
the events that can be used instead to allow these metrics to be gathered 
concurrently.  Those alternative encodings were added to libpfm by:

commit ed3f51c4690685675cf2766edb90acbc0c1cdb67 (upstream/master, master)
Author: Will Schmidt <will_schm...@vnet.ibm.com>
Date:   Sun Dec 3 09:42:44 2017 -0800

    Add alternate event numbers for power9.
    
    I had previously missed adding the _ALT entries, which allow some
    events to be specified on different counters. This patch fills
    those in.
    
    This patch also adds a few validation tests for the ALT events.
    
    Signed-off-by: Will Schmidt  <will_schm...@vnet.ibm.com>

However, the above mentioned patch uses the same names multiple times once for 
the orginal event and another time for the alternative encoding.  This made it 
impossible to select select the alternative events by name. The follow on patch 
makes the names unique. I took a look through the power9_events.h and this 
patch.  The event pme_codes are different between the normal and alt version of 
the events.

>     Older versions of PAPI use the event name to look up the libpfm event
>     number when doing the enumeration of the available events.  If there
>     were multiple events with the same name in libpfm, the earliest one
>     would be selected.  This selection would cause the enumeration of
>     events in papi_native_avail to get stuck looping on the first
>     duplicated named event in a pmu.  In the case of IBM Power 9 the
>     enumeration would get stuck on PM_CO0_BUSY. Gave each event a unique
>     name to avoid this unfortunate behavior.
